If you don't know when the last oil change was, you should at the very least, do this. When you buy a used car, you should always check into (and do) all the maintenance stuff up to that point in the car's life. You can never be sure if the previous owner did any of it.
That maintenance light does not necessarily mean anything. All it means is that it was reset about 7000 miles ago. It doesn't mean that any work was done about 7000 miles ago. Most people know about this light, go by their own schedule and just ignore the light. They just reset it when it comes on.
ps. You nearest service interval IS 63,750 miles. Your next one is 67,500. If you go by the book, it is not on the 5000 mile interval. You really should get an owner's manual or Helm manual.
